Websites hosted on 93.113.111.54 IP address

1 websites

IP address 93.113.111.54 is registered for United Kingdom. The server carries IP 93.113.111.54 located at latitude 51.3305 and longitude -0.27011, time zone is GMT +1. Server location in England, Epsom, United Kingdom, zipcode KT18.

Let's share 💋💋💋